Summary

Dr. Gabriela Mastromonaco will provide a PowerPoint Presentation on the recent advancements in genome-based technologies and the promising solutions they may offer for conservation. However, they may also carry risks of ecological disruption and other unintended consequences. Your Toronto Zoo's conservation science team is working to better understand whether the growing interest in generating charismatic genetically modified organisms, like the woolly mammoth, is a valuable pursuit or an unnecessary distraction.
